With this company, Tharp developed the material that would go on to become Movin ' Out, a musical featuring the songs of Billy Joel and featuring most of the dancers that were in Tharp Dance.
Tharp premiered her dance musical Movin ' Out, set to the music and lyrics of Billy Joel in Chicago in 2001.
Movin ' Out ran for 1, 331 performances on Broadway.
Movin ' Out received ten Tony nominations and Tharp was named Best Choreographer.
She received the Tony Award for Best Choreography and the Drama Desk Award for Outstanding Choreography for the 2002 musical Movin ' Out.

The Stranger contained nine songs ; " Movin ' Out ( Anthony's Song )," " She's Always a Woman ," " Just the Way You Are ," " Everybody Has a Dream ," and " Only the Good Die Young " were all written prior to recording, while " Vienna ," " Scenes from an Italian Restaurant ," " The Stranger ," and " Get It Right the First Time " all came from short tunes or fragments of songs that Joel finished in the studio.
Four singles from the LP charted on the Billboard Hot 100 in the following order: " Just the Way You Are " (# 3 ), " Movin ' Out " (# 17 ), " Only the Good Die Young " (# 24 ), and " She's Always a Woman " (# 17 ).
Singles released from the album include " Just the Way You Are " ( which won the Grammy for both Record of the Year and Song of the Year ), the acoustic ballad " She's Always A Woman ," the mildly controversial " Only the Good Die Young ," and " Movin ' Out ( Anthony's Song )," which later lent its title to Movin ' Out, an acclaimed hit Broadway musical based on Billy Joel's songs.
